Book Details
Edition Notes
At head of title: U. S. Department of labor. James J. Davis, secretary. Children's bureau. Grace Abbott, chief.
"The investigation was directly in charge of Estelle B. Hunter. Dr. Robert M. Woodbury was responsible for the interpretation of the statistical findings, and has written the appendix on Method of procedure; Elizabeth Hughes, who has written the main body of the report, was the supervisor of the local field work." - Letter of transmittal, p. vii.
